What is protection work notice form

The Protection Work Notice Form 3 is a legal document used by property owners in Victoria, Australia to notify adjoining owners about intended building work and request agreement on proposed protection measures.

Understanding the Protection Work Notice Form 3

The Protection Work Notice Form 3 serves a critical role under the Building Act 1993 in Victoria. This legal document is utilized by property owners to inform adjoining owners about intended building work that may necessitate protective measures. It establishes the legal context by outlining conditions under which the form must be served, ensuring compliance with local regulations.
Serving this notice to an adjoining owner is vital, as it legally obligates them to acknowledge the proposed building work and respond appropriately, which can significantly influence the success of the construction project.

Property owners planning any construction work that may affect adjoining properties in Victoria are eligible to use this form to formally notify adjacent owners under the Building Act 1993.
Adjoining owners must respond to the Protection Work Notice Form 3 within 14 days. A timely response is required to prevent delays in the planned building work.
The completed Protection Work Notice Form 3 can be submitted via mail or delivered in person to the adjoining owner. If using pdfFiller, you may directly send it through the platform after completion.
Typically, no additional documents are required to accompany the Protection Work Notice Form 3, but providing copies of project plans or permits may be beneficial for clarity.
Common mistakes include failing to provide complete information, using outdated contact details, and not verifying the form for accuracy before submission. Always double-check to avoid these pitfalls.
Processing times may vary depending on how quickly the adjoining owner responds. After your submission, ensure to follow up if you do not receive a response within the stipulated 14-day period.
There are generally no fees for completing or submitting the Protection Work Notice Form 3, but costs may arise if legal consultation or additional documentation is needed.
